> RealXtend is currently undergoing some major changes.  The 0.5 RealXtend
> that you're looking at is quite old.  The viewer that you are probably using
> (0.42) is quite old, and is no longer supported as well.
>
> The future will be the Naali viewer, but it's in an extremely early
> (pre-Alpha) stage, and it will be quite some time before Naali reaches the
> same maturity as the previous 0.42 viewer.
>
> No the developers can't go back and look at the previous viewer, and the
> reasons for this are the old viewer was GPL based, and the new viewer is a
> BSD license based viewer.
>
> This was one of the main reasons why we moved away from the old "LL" based
> viewer.
